6,9,10-Trihydroxy-3,3-dimethyl-8-(3-methylbut-2-enyl)pyrano[2,3-c]xanthen-7-one
Internal ID | 8181857d-bc8d-46a4-8272-a5c969ed02ac |
Taxonomy | Organoheterocyclic compounds > Benzopyrans > 1-benzopyrans > Xanthones > 8-prenylated xanthones |
IUPAC Name | 6,9,10-trihydroxy-3,3-dimethyl-8-(3-methylbut-2-enyl)pyrano[2,3-c]xanthen-7-one |
SMILES (Canonical) | CC(=CCC1=C(C(=CC2=C1C(=O)C3=C(O2)C4=C(C=C3O)OC(C=C4)(C)C)O)O)C |
SMILES (Isomeric) | CC(=CCC1=C(C(=CC2=C1C(=O)C3=C(O2)C4=C(C=C3O)OC(C=C4)(C)C)O)O)C |
InChI | InChI=1S/C23H22O6/c1-11(2)5-6-13-18-17(10-15(25)20(13)26)28-22-12-7-8-23(3,4)29-16(12)9-14(24)19(22)21(18)27/h5,7-10,24-26H,6H2,1-4H3 |
InChI Key | BQNZDKWHGWGLMT-UHFFFAOYSA-N |
Popularity | 1 reference in papers |
Molecular Formula | C23H22O6 |
Molecular Weight | 394.40 g/mol |
Exact Mass | 394.14163842 g/mol |
Topological Polar Surface Area (TPSA) | 96.20 Ų |
XlogP | 5.30 |
